Maine Statutes

§ 36 §3206 — Licenses; users

Maine·Title 36 TAXATION·Part 5 MOTOR FUEL TAXES·Ch. 459 SPECIAL FUEL TAX ACT
It is unlawful for any user to use or consume any special fuel within this State, unless that user is the holder of an uncanceled license issued by the State Tax Assessor. To produce that license, every user shall file with the State Tax Assessor an application in such form as the State Tax Assessor may prescribe, setting forth the name and address of the user. Any unlicensed user who purchases a fuel use identification decal, as required by Title 29‑A, section 525, must be registered by the State Tax Assessor and subject to this chapter and chapter 461.
